Angular Master Podcast

Dariusz Kalbarczyk
Angular Master Podcast Podcast

Learn, grow and connect with the Angular community like never before. The Angular Master Podcast is a broadcast aimed at all Angular developers. We cover topics such as building production-ready applications, architecture and performance best practices, and delving into the components of the framework. Listen / Code / Repeat. Everything you need to know to become a super Angular developer. https://ng-poland.pl https://js-poland.pl https://angularmaster.dev https://workshopfest.dev

  1. AMP 64: Exploring Modern Angular with Manfred Steyer

    29 AUG

    AMP 64: Exploring Modern Angular with Manfred Steyer

    Welcome to the Angular Master Podcast! I’m Dariusz Kalbarczyk, co-founder of NG Poland, JS Poland, AngularMaster.dev & WorkshopFest.dev, and in this episode, I’m thrilled to have the brilliant Manfred Steyer join me. 🌟 Manfred, a leading expert in the Angular community, dives deep into the world of Modern Angular. Together, we explore the latest features, tools, and architectural approaches that are transforming how we build large-scale Angular applications. In this episode, we cover: The power of Standalone Components and APIs. Innovations like Signals and the move towards Zone-less change detection. Enhancing performance with SSR (Server-Side Rendering) and Deferred Loading. The shift away from traditional field decorators to new functions. Key updates in Angular 18 and what they mean for developers. Strategies for adapting architecture in large-scale Angular projects. Managing migration and ensuring seamless code interoperability. A comparison between Signals and Observables. Manfred’s personal journey and his significant contributions to Angular. Whether you’re looking to stay ahead with the latest Angular updates or need insights into managing large projects, this episode has something for everyone. Don’t forget to like, comment, and subscribe for more expert insights from the Angular world! https://bit.ly/amp64-spotify https://bit.ly/amp64-podcasters https://youtu.be/6lJrmi2Ql70 https://bit.ly/amp64-apple #Angular #WebDevelopment #Podcast #ModernAngular #ManfredSteyer #NGPoland #Frontend #JavaScript #SSR #Signals #ZoneLess #AngularMasterPodcast

    48 min
  2. AMP 61: Muhammad Ahsan Ayaz on Managing 80+ Angular Projects

    14 JUN

    AMP 61: Muhammad Ahsan Ayaz on Managing 80+ Angular Projects

    Welcome back to the Angular Master Podcast! I'm your host, Dariusz Kalbarczyk, co-founder of NG Poland, JS Poland, AngularMaster.dev, and WorkshopFest.dev. In this episode, we're thrilled to welcome a special guest from Stockholm, Sweden: Muhammad Ahsan Ayaz. Ahsan is an educator, author, Google Developers Expert, software architect, and speaker who has an incredible wealth of knowledge and experience in the Angular community. In this episode, Ahsan shares his journey and the challenges he faced while managing over 80 independent Angular projects. Tune in to hear Ahsan discuss: The common problems encountered in managing large-scale Angular projects. Overcoming the "Frankenstein's Monster" state of a sprawling codebase. Differences in codebase management between the first and second editions of the "Angular Cookbook." Why NX workspaces were chosen for project management and the alternatives considered. How custom generators and automation in NX significantly reduced development time. Achieving consistency across projects with NX schematics. The custom NX plugin developed by Ahsan to streamline project setup and naming conventions. Challenges in convincing teams and stakeholders to adopt NX workspaces. Key benefits of using NX workspaces for large-scale Angular projects. The most rewarding aspects of achieving true code harmony across 80+ projects. In addition to the technical deep dive, we get to know Ahsan on a personal level. He shares insights into self-organization, his favorite hobbies, and maintaining a healthy work/life balance. Whether you're an Angular developer or simply interested in effective project management, this episode is packed with valuable insights and practical advice. Don't miss it!

    31 min
  3. AMP 58: Michael Egger-Zikes on Angular’s Advanced Application Architecture

    17 MAY

    AMP 58: Michael Egger-Zikes on Angular’s Advanced Application Architecture

    🚀 New episode of the Angular Master Podcast is out now! 🚀 This time, we have a special guest from Graz, Austria: Michael Egger-Zikes! 🎙️ Michael is a trainer, consultant, speaker, web enthusiast, Micro Frontend architect, and software entrepreneur. In this episode, we dive into Angular’s advanced application architecture. 📌 In this episode, we discuss: Standalone Components and their benefits in business application development Architectural challenges in large enterprise-scale Angular projects Transitioning from traditional monoliths to Moduliths Advantages of the Mono Repo approach and Strategic Design principles Maintaining architectural integrity with tools like Nx and Sheriff Key considerations for implementing Micro Frontend architectures with Module Federation Performance improvements from leveraging esbuild The significance of Angular Signals and its integration into modern Angular architectures Enhancing state management with the NGRX Signal Store and its benefits Developing custom features within the NGRX Signal Store for complex scenarios Strategies for planning and deploying enterprise-scale Angular applications Common mistakes teams make when adopting new Angular technologies Future trends in Angular development Advice for budding Angular developers and architects to enhance their skills and understanding of modern web architectures Tune in now to get these valuable insights! And don't miss the chance to see Michael at our upcoming NG Learn 2024 workshops! #Angular #Podcast #WebDevelopment #MicroFrontends #SoftwareArchitecture #AngularMasterPodcast #FrontendDevelopment #NGLearn2024

    34 min

About

Learn, grow and connect with the Angular community like never before. The Angular Master Podcast is a broadcast aimed at all Angular developers. We cover topics such as building production-ready applications, architecture and performance best practices, and delving into the components of the framework. Listen / Code / Repeat. Everything you need to know to become a super Angular developer. https://ng-poland.pl https://js-poland.pl https://angularmaster.dev https://workshopfest.dev

To listen to explicit episodes, sign in.

Stay up to date with this show

Sign in or sign up to follow shows, save episodes and get the latest updates.

Select a country or region

Africa, Middle East, and India

Asia Pacific

Europe

Latin America and the Caribbean

The United States and Canada